Description
Chocolate Pumpkin Butter Cups are a delightful combination of creamy pumpkin spice filling encased in rich dark chocolate. These treats are lower in sugar, dairy-free, and perfect for a festive indulgence.
Ingredients
Pumpkin Spice Filling
- 1/2 cup Pumpkin Puree
- 1/3 cup Almond Butter (Any nut butter will work! Sunbutter can also be used)
- 2 tablespoons Honey (Maple syrup can be used as a substitute)
- 2 teaspoons Pumpkin Spice
Chocolate Layer
- 1 cup Chocolate Chips
- 1 tablespoon Coconut Oil
Instructions
- Pumpkin Spice Filling – Microwave almond butter for 30 seconds. Mix almond butter, pumpkin puree, honey, and pumpkin spice until smooth.
- Melting Chocolate – Melt chocolate chips and coconut oil in a glass bowl in 20-second increments.
- Assembling Chocolate Pumpkin Cups – Pour a thin chocolate layer into molds. Freeze. Pipe pumpkin spice mixture over chocolate. Freeze. Add another chocolate layer. Freeze until firm.
Notes
- You can use any silicone candy mold for this recipe. Mini pumpkin molds are festive!
- For smaller candies, do not fill the mold to the top for thinner layers.
- Store leftovers in the freezer in an airtight container to maintain freshness.
